CHAMPION CORNETIST.
RETURN TO THE DOMINION. , (Per Press Association.) WELLINGTON, This Day. Mr J. McL. Robertson, who: was champion cornet player of the Dominion in 1927, returned to-day by the Rangitiki. During his seven years’ absence he has played in a number of well-known bands and orchestras in Britain, America and Australia. He has also been featured on the air in New York and London. He intends to settle in New Zealand. He may compete at the bands’ championship at Timaru next week.
